Abstract

A volatile alkene sensing device includes a gas pathway having a desiccant area located upstream of a sensor, wherein the sensor is disposed in a housing. The sensor includes a conductive region in electrical communication with two electrodes. The conductive region includes nanosized particles of a metal dichalcogenide, a mercaptoimidazolyl metal-ligand complex, and single-walled carbon nanotubes or metallic nanowires.
